Gift of Hope to ASHA DEEP
ASHA DEEP ("Light of Hope") is a hostel for girls ages five to sixteen inb Bangalore, India, administrered by the Daughters of Wisdom religious community. The Glaser Fund has provided a gift of $10,000.00 to benefit the children of ASHA DEEP.
